Garage occupancy feed (Project Stallwatch) runbook. Feed polls sensor hubs at the Corbin Street and Ashvale garages every 30s. Stale data flag trips after three missed polls. First: check the hub heartbeat dashboard. If hubs are up but counts frozen, restart the aggregator, not the hubs. Negative occupancy means a counter desync — run the reconcile job, never edit rows by hand. Overnight resets run at 03:10 local; alerts during that window are expected noise. Full escalation chain and dashboard links:

operations page: https://confluence.qorvelsys.internal/browse/display/display/display

Currency Hedging Decision — Managers Only

For the incoming director: Ostrell Group hedges 70% of forecast kronet exposure via forward contracts, rolling quarterly. Decision taken after the Q2 swing cost us margin on the Larnow contract. Options were rejected as too costly. Treasury reviews coverage each month-end. Exceptions require director sign-off. The strategic rationale is set out in the confidential note directly below.

management briefing: Project Ulavan slips by two quarters because of the staffing delay.

TICKET: Recon job blocked — expired creds

The nightly inventory reconciliation on Stockmarrow failed since Tuesday; the warehouse-sync credential expired and retries are piling up. Release impact: Thursday cut needs a clean recon run. Fix: swap in the reissued credential and rerun the job manually once. The new key for the Stockmarrow internal service is directly below this line.

API key for yahig-tadup: kto7_ubizbYm